Box Score 2 LA MIRADA, Calif. - The Fresno Pacific tennis teams met resistance in the conference matchups against Biola University. Although the Sunbirds pulled through with two big wins in their singles matches, both of the Eagle tennis teams clinched the win 1-6 to end the day.
Early in the afternoon, the Lady 'Birds started off with a competitive match on the No. 2 doubles court. Fellow Sunbirds
Halle Faherty and
Jessica McLean led the charge with a score of 6-7 before heading into a tiebreaker for all the marbles. Despite their efforts, Biola won the doubles point with the win over Margarita Munoz and
Malia Mitchell (3-6). An unforgettable moment occurred on the No. 1 singles court, where
Yume Ueoku challenged the Eagles' top player and valiantly pushed through to win the match (6-3, 6-2).
"Congrats to Biola, they played very well today," said head coach
Sam Gaeddert. "We had some bright spots in doubles and Yume is playing very well in singles, both today and throughout the season. Today is a learning experience for us as we move forward."
The Sunbird men kicked things off with tough doubles matches.
Cedric Kaufmann and
Joaquin Salinas led the Sunbirds' offense on court one, but were defeated 4-6.
Tim Bangert and Ryoma Okamato put up a fight on court three, managing to keep the Eagles on their toes for a moment, before they loss the doubles match 7-5.
Emilio Seelbach and
Jordi Gonzalez were resilient on court two tying it up at 6-6 although the match went unfinished. The Blue and Orange struggled in the singles matches, but it was Seelbach who clinched the sole victory for the 'Birds (6-2, 5-7, 10-3), ending with a final score of FPU 1 - BU 6.
"I thought the men battled well today, especially in doubles. Biola is a solid team and we played them well. I'm encouraged each match by the fight that we have and I'm looking forward to watching them continue to put it all together."
